How To Rest When You Are Afraid of Tomorrow
from Quiet In The Night · host Bill Scott
If you're lying awake tonight… worried about tomorrow… this is for you. Fear has a way of creeping in when everything gets quiet. The "what ifs" get louder. The unknown feels heavy. And rest can feel impossible. But God meets you right here—in the middle of the night, in the middle of your thoughts, in the middle of your fear. Tonight's devotional will gently walk you into rest—not because everything is solved… but because God is still in control. You'll be reminded that: You don't have to carry tomorrow tonight God is already in your future His peace is available right now—even in the unknown Take a deep breath… slow your thoughts… and let this be a moment where your soul finds rest again. 📖 Scriptures are read in full (KJV) 🙏 Includes a peaceful prayer at the end 🎧 Designed to help you rest, reflect, and fall asleep in God's presence If this helped you tonight, consider subscribing so you always have a place to come back to when the night feels heavy.
